hotspot/src/share/vm/interpreter/templateInterpreter.cpp
address TemplateInterpreterGenerator::generate_error_exit(const char* msg) {
{- -------------------------------------------
(1) (ここからが生成するコードの始まり)
---------------------------------------- -}
address entry = __ pc();
{- -------------------------------------------
(1) コード生成:
「強制的に停止させる」
---------------------------------------- -}
__ stop(msg);
{- -------------------------------------------
(1) 以上で生成したコードの先頭アドレスをリターン.
---------------------------------------- -}
return entry;
}
This document is available under the GNU GENERAL PUBLIC LICENSE Version 2.